Adam Landerman (clockwise from top left), Alisa Massaro, Joshua Miner, and Bethany McKee are charged with first degree murder after allegedly strangling two men to death and attempting to dismember them Thursday, January 10, 2013. Police say they were surprised to be caught and three of them were found playing video games with the bodies in another room. Each suspect is being held on a $10 million bond. According to CBS Chicago, one of the suspects is the son of a Joliet police sergeant.
